Reasons to book a car rental in Tasmania

Renting a car in Tasmania offers the freedom and flexibility to explore this beautiful state at your own pace. With a rental car, you can easily manage your luggage and create a travel itinerary that suits your interests. Whether you're seeking outdoor adventures, stunning scenery, or city experiences, having your own vehicle makes it simple to visit key attractions. For instance, you can drive to Salamanca Place in Hobart to enjoy the vibrant city atmosphere, or explore the breathtaking Cataract Gorge in Launceston, ideal for those who appreciate nature and adventure. If you're drawn to dramatic landscapes, Cradle Mountain is easily accessible, allowing you to experience its natural beauty without the constraints of public transportation. A rental car enables you to visit these popular destinations and attractions conveniently, making it particularly appealing for travelers seeking adventure and scenic experiences. Overall, renting a car in Tasmania ensures that you have the flexibility to discover everything this incredible state has to offer, from its charming cities to its awe-inspiring outdoor landscapes.

Where to stay in Tasmania

  • Hobart: Hobart is a vibrant city that offers a mix of outdoor, city-themed, and family experiences. Visitors can explore attractions such as Salamanca Place, a street perfect for city vacations, and Franklin Wharf, a scenic jetty. The Museum of Old and New Art is also nearby, providing a cultural experience. With access to public markets and recreational areas, Hobart is an ideal base for those looking to enjoy local wines and restaurants. The best time to visit is during the warmer months when outdoor activities are in full swing.
  • Launceston: Launceston is known for its stunning scenery and adventurous activities, making it per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Key attractions include the breathtaking Cataract Gorge, which offers various hiking trails and scenic views. The Brisbane Street Mall provides a lively city atmosphere, while Penny Royal Adventures adds a touch of history to your stay. With a variety of nearby wineries and restaurants, Launceston offers ample dining options. The ideal time to explore this region is in spring and summer when the natural beauty is at its peak.

10 tips to save on your car rental in Tasmania

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le type and specific features. Whether you're looking for an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er drives, or an economy car for budget-friendliness, utilize the filters on Expedia to identify the best options for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ates vary based on demand, making it wise to reserve your vehicle well ahead of your trip. By booking early, you are more likely to secure lower prices and enjoy greater availability, especially during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les typically cost less to rent and are easier to maneuver and park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als strike a good balance between affordability,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ily fees,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or premium models—might not be accessible. This could also apply to renters over the age of 70. Always verify the age requirements before completing your re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rental agreements require a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ional fees. This is often the best choice. Others may provide full-to-empty or prepaid fueling options, which can also be convenient. Just ensure that you return the vehicle empty in such cases.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at the airport often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may justify the c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provide peace of mind in case of unforeseen events during your trip. Adding car rental insurance is straightforward when booking through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If your plans include long road trips, seek out rentals that offer unlimited mileage to steer clear of additional char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.

Best time to rent a car in Tasmania

The best value period to rent a car in Tasmania is August, when prices are moderately low and demand is at its lowest. This month offers a great opportunity for budget-conscious travelers. June and July also feature lower prices and less demand, making them good options as well. However, December tends to be the most expensive month with high demand, while January and February follow closely behind with similarly high demand and moderately high prices.

What do you need to rent a car in Tasmania?
You'll need to present a valid driver's license and a credit card at the rental counter. Prior to the pickup date, check with your selected company whether anything else is needed. For example, you may also need to show proof of insurance.

Where can I find a Tasmania car rental if I am younger than 25?
Whether or not you can rent a vehicle if you're under 25 years in Tasmania often depends on the rental company you select. Some outlets apply a surcharge for young customers aged between 21 and 24 years, but other companies may not apply any additional costs for this age range. Make sure you read the terms and conditions of your selected car rental dealer to escape excessive charges when picking up your keys.
